Smart Memory v3.1 Skill
Smart Memory v3.1 is a local transcript-first cognitive memory runtime with revision-aware derivation, pinned context lanes, entity-aware retrieval, and bounded prompt composition.
Core runtime:
- Node adapter:
smart-memory/index.js - Local API:
server.py - System facade:
cognitive_memory_system.py - Canonical store:
storage/sqlite_memory_store.pyplustranscripts/
Core Capabilities
- transcript-first ingest and per-message transcript logging
- typed long-term memory including
preference,identity, andtask_state - evidence-backed revision lifecycle decisions and supersession chains
- explicit core and working memory lanes
- entity-aware retrieval with lightweight relationship hints
- deterministic rebuild from transcript history
- hot-memory compatibility projection for working context
- strict token-bounded prompt composition with trace metadata
- inspection endpoints for transcripts, evidence, history, lanes, and eval runs

Tool Interface
memory_search
- purpose: query relevant memory through
/retrieve - supports
query,type,limit,min_relevance, and optionalconversation_history - health-checks the backend before execution
memory_commit
- purpose: persist important facts, decisions, beliefs, goals, or session summaries
- health-checks the backend before execution
- serializes commits to protect local embedding throughput
- queues failed commits in
.memory_retry_queue.json
memory_insights
- purpose: surface pending background insights
- health-checks the backend before execution
- calls
/insights/pending

Operating guidance
- query memory before speaking when continuity matters
- do not claim prior context unless retrieval actually supports it
- transcripts are canonical, memories are derived
- treat SQLite as canonical runtime storage
- treat JSON as offline export or backup only
- keep CPU-only PyTorch policy intact

How the grade is calculated
Each check contributes 0 points when it passes, 1 when it warns, and 2 when it fails. The total maps to a letter:
- Aevery check passed
- Bone warning
- Ctwo warnings
- Dprompt injection or body integrity failed, or three warnings
- Fone of those failed, and something else is wrong
These are automated hygiene checks, not a security audit, and not a dependency or vulnerability scan. A grade of A means nothing was flagged — not that the artifact is safe.
